DHC has shifted from a distressed, rate-sensitive REIT to a credible turnaround story with improving margins and raised guidance, but after the recent momentum-driven re-rating, the stock's upside now depends on proving that SHOP NOI gains and cost cuts are durable enough to offset heavy leverage, high interest expense, and refinancing risk.
